Thu, July 17, 2025
MOTION TO RECOMMIT65

H.R. 4 - filing multiple motions to recommit with different instructions

Impact: 45 min · Confidence: 85%

Filing multiple motions to recommit (at least 3) for the same bill with different instructions is a classic dilatory tactic designed to force procedural votes and delay final passage of H.R. 4.

View floor text
Mr. President, I ask unanimous consent that the following motions to recommit for the bill H.R. 4 be placed in the Congressional Record: Mr. Warnock moves to recommit the bill H.R. 4 to the Committee on Appropriations of the Senate with instructions to report the same back to the Senate in 3 days, not counting any day on which the Senate is not in session, with changes that-- (1) are within the jurisdiction of such committee; and (2) would protect funding for the production and distribution of programming to support early childhood development. Mr. Warnock moves to recommit the bill H.R. 4 to the Committee on Appropriations of the Senate with instructions to report the same back to the Senate in 3 days, not counting any day on which the Senate is not in session, with changes that-- (1) are within the jurisdiction of such committee; and (2) would protect funding to support emergency alert systems during natural disasters. Mr. Warnock moves to recommit the bill H.R. 4 to the Committee on Appropriations of the Senate with instructions to report the same back to the Senate in 3 days, not counting any day on which the Senate is not in session, with changes that-- (1) are within the jurisdiction of such committee; and (2) would protect funding to support rural broadcasting and journalism.
